Patagonia, pioneers and specialists in ecological outdoor clothing have brought out this fantastic, stylish, storm-proof anorak made from recycled material. Tested under the worst conditions, this eco-friendly jacket delivers exceptional performance to get you home dry. The slick Rain Shell technology combines two layers: an outer, breathable, rainproof layer and an inner mesh lining – both made from recycled polyester.
Zip-up and Get Home in Style
As well as the ‘H2No’ barrier this jacket has a range of useful functions. It’s got a 2-way zipper with storm flap; a zip-off hood; a soft micro-fleece-backed chin flap; a drawcord hem; and plenty of pockets. The regular fit accomodates layers.
Key Features:
Inner and outer layers made from recycled polyester; 2-way zipper with storm flap; zip-off hood; microfleece-backed chin flap; drawcord hem; plenty of pockets; drawstring hem; loop closure on cuffs.
